🌟Vuex Actions使用指南✨

导读 Vuex是Vue.js中管理状态的核心工具,而actions和mutations作为其重要组成部分,各自承担着不同的职责。🤔 今天,让我们一起探索它们的区...

Vuex是Vue.js中管理状态的核心工具,而actions和mutations作为其重要组成部分,各自承担着不同的职责。🤔 今天,让我们一起探索它们的区别吧!

首先,mutations 是用于直接修改state的状态工具,它必须是同步操作。就像你手里的遥控器,按下按钮就能立刻改变电视的画面。🎯 而 actions 则更像一个计划表,负责处理异步任务,并通过提交mutations来间接修改state。换句话说,actions更像是你的大脑,先思考再指挥行动。🧠

举个例子:当你点击按钮触发某个事件时,action会先处理可能需要的API请求(如数据获取),完成后调用mutation更新界面展示的数据。⏳ 这种分工合作的方式,让整个应用逻辑更加清晰有序。

总结来说,mutations负责同步修改,actions则处理复杂逻辑与异步操作。掌握这两者的区别,能让你更好地驾驭Vuex的强大功能!💪

前端开发 VueJS 编程学习